"Fruit for the 2024 Hutton Reserve Margaret River Chardonnay was sourced from the Wildberry Springs vineyard in Wilyabrup. The Gin Gin and clone 3 and 5 grapes were hand picked in January, chilled overnight, then gently whole-bunch pressed. The free run juice and light pressings were fermented naturally with wild yeasts in French barriques (22% new) and malolactic fermentation was encouraged. The wine was matured for 8 months in barrel with minimal battonage. Bottling was in December and 221 cases were produced." - Hutton Wines, Winemaker
"Gracefully opulent and immensely complex, the wine shows golden peach, grapefruit, fig, vanilla, and cedar characters with a hint of savoury pastry. The palate has power as well as poise, displaying richly textured mouthfeel backed by perfectly pitched acidity with a superbly long, expansive finish. A sublime chardonnay with a majestic presence. At its best: 2027 to 2041 - 98 Points, Sam Kim, Wine Orbit
"There’s chardonnay and then there’s chardonnay like this. This is an electrifying white wine with fanfare and fireworks in abundance. It’s flinty and taut, aflame with grapefruit, white peach, citrus and apple flavour, and comes rippled with characters of woodsmoke, pebbles, cedar-spice, fennel and gun smoke. The flint notes here add plenty of drama and flare, but the tension and power of the fruit are what makes this wine so special. This is Margaret River Chardonnay at its extreme best." - 97 Points, Campbell Mattinson
"Power, poise, and persistence, that’s what you’re getting in this deluxe Chardonnay from a vintage that produced some quite marvelous examples of this variety from Margaret River. The nose has a slightly gun flint-like character, with a faint struck match influence. Notes of butterscotch and honeycomb, deep stone fruit, cashew, and a chalky acidity combine on a deeply intense and powerfully penetrating palate. There’s plenty of grunt in this wine, but it delivers with focus and refinement, and great control." - 96 Points, Ray Jordan, Wine Pilot
